Yutian
Yutian County (于田县) is a county in the Hotan (Khotan) Prefecture of the Xinjiang Uygur Autonomous Region, China. It is located in the southern part of Xinjiang, within the Tarim Basin, and borders desert and mountain areas. The county seat is Yutian Town (于田镇).
